MOSCOW, November 5 (RIA Novosti) - The Russian natural gas producer Itera said on Wednesday its net profit calculated to Russian Accounting Standards grew 75% year-on-year in January-September to 4.05 billion rubles ($149 million).
Revenues from gas sales in the reporting period grew 46% from a year ago to 30.93 billion rubles ($1.15 billion), Itera said.
Itera, which has authorized capital of 60 mln rubles ($2.2 mln), attributed growth in revenue to higher natural gas tariffs and increased gas sales.
